this is how I gained mpg

I've seen a lot of gas mileage questions lately and everyone is always interested in the subject anyways, so with that said:

1.stock + 2.hypertech = 17.5 (these are all avg mph with city and country driving)

1,2, 3. full synthetic oil + stock size k&n = 17.75

1,2,3, 4. drop base open element = 18 (if not more)

1,2,3,4, 5. cat back = 20

1,2,3,4,5, 6. k&n for open element = 20.2

*with just cat and y pipe I only gained about .3, not even worth the probelms

interested in how I'll do know with no cat and a flat base open element (no spacer ring)

hope this helps everyone

Vic / Mrs. LBC,

What rear end ratios are you running? That can make a big difference in highway mileage, but very little difference between stoplights.
